Republicans reject complaint about Gabbard as Democrats question time it took to see it
The Republican lawmakers in charge of the House and Senate intelligence committees have rejected an anonymous complaint from last year alleging that Director of National Intelligence Tulsi Gabbard withheld access to classified information for political reasons
